The Verrückt

Picture From Here

The Verruckt is a large water slide built in Kansas City, MO that most people think is up to 17 stories tall, but no one knows exactly how tall it is until May 23rd. On the water slide you will be going down a 5 stories hill at 65 mph. Whenever the Verrnuckt opens it will set a world record for the tallest water slide ever built by Jeff Henry a.k.a. The Wizard of Water. Jeff is called the Wizard of Water because he is a wizard of all things water fun. The Verrnuckt is as tall or taller than the Statue of Liberty or Niagara Falls. The Verrnuck is different from the Insano of Brazil because of the height difference. The Insano is about 14 stories tall, and the Verrnuckt is or might be 17 stories tall. Mini Windmills


Picture From Here

This paragraph is all about tiny windmills that can soon power our cell phones and if you buy lots and lots, you can power your home with them! The maker of this new invention is Jung-Chih Chiao. Measuring down to 1.8 millimeters that there widest point these tint windmills can easily fit 1000 inside your phone case. The windmills can hold up to very strong wind power, but the downside is the windmills could not charge a phone during an hour or more phone call, but they can keep the phone charged to send out a text that means life or death in some cases. The reason for this invention is the maker wanted to make an emergency phone charger that doesn't use solar power because the sun isn't out all day, but the wind is almost always blowing, day or night.
